Quick Answer
Super League Enterprise, Inc. reported Operating Income Loss of -$13.05 million for the year ending 2025.
- Super League Enterprise, Inc. showed an increase of +22.1% in Operating Income Loss from 2024 to 2025.
- This data is from Super League Enterprise, Inc.'s annual report (Form 10-K), filed with the SEC on March 31, 2026.
- XBRL data for this metric is available from 2018 to 2025 (8 years of filings). Earlier data may not exist in machine-readable XBRL format as companies adopted electronic filing at different times.
- Quarterly values from 10-Q filings: Q1 2018: -$4.13 million | Q2 2018: -$3.60 million | Q3 2018: -$3.56 million | Q1 2019: -$6.14 million | Q2 2019: -$5.51 million | Q3 2019: -$4.43 million | Q1 2020: -$5.15 million | Q2 2020: -$4.56 million | Q3 2020: -$4.30 million | Q1 2021: -$4.63 million | Q2 2021: -$6.31 million | Q3 2021: -$6.97 million | Q1 2022: -$7.96 million | Q2 2022: -$8.74 million | Q3 2022: -$52.08 million | Q1 2023: -$7.22 million | Q2 2023: -$8.19 million | Q3 2023: -$4.50 million | Q1 2024: -$4.61 million | Q2 2024: -$4.09 million | Q3 2024: -$3.45 million | Q1 2025: -$3.63 million | Q2 2025: -$3.15 million | Q3 2025: -$3.05 million.
- Over the full 8 years of available data (2018 to 2025), Super League Enterprise, Inc.'s Operating Income Loss has grown by 19.2%.
- Historical annual values: Fiscal year 2025: -$13.05 million | Fiscal year 2024: -$16.75 million | Fiscal year 2023: -$32.84 million | Fiscal year 2022: -$84.96 million | Fiscal year 2021: -$25.08 million | Fiscal year 2020: -$18.74 million | Fiscal year 2019: -$20.77 million | Fiscal year 2018: -$16.16 million.
